There are only a few days left before the local SPCA shuts its doors for the holiday season. The staff is busy getting pets ready for the holiday break. In hopes, foster parents will come by and take a pet into their home. The facility is closed for two weeks and staff would like the surrendered pets to have loving homes during the time. Temporarily adopting an animal gives the foster parent an opportunity to try if a new animal will work in their home. Saturday, December 23rd is the last day to adopt a pet for the holidays. The shelter will start transitioning the pets back at the beginning of the New Year…Assuming you don’t want to keep your new furry friend.
